Abstract

In this article, the author proposes a modification of Dodge-Romig single rectifying inspection plan with average outgoing quality limit (AOQL) protection. The quality investment and inspection error are considered in the modified model.  The optimal parameters of sampling inspection plan and quality investment level are simultaneously determined by minimizing the expected total cost of product under the specified AOQL value. Finally, the comparison of solution between the modified model with/without inspection error will be provided for illustration.   Key words: Dodge-Romig Single Rectifying Inspection Pan, average outgoing quality limit (AOQL), quality investment, inspection error.
